Hey, here is a quick easy option for transfering files
from ipod to any mac.  It is called XPOD.
I will attech file to email if not to big,  If doesn't
work or you don't trust attachments, I think I found
it on Cnet's downloads.com.  Or just google search for
it.  Install on computer.  Then attach Ipod.  Then
drag app onto ipod disk image.  Then you can take
anywhere.  On any computer just plug in ipod, say no
to emptying ipod.  then double click on ipod disk
image.  then run xpod.  it will allow you to sync all
hidden files.  By the way, the ipod is a great
transport for any files not just mp3's.  You can stoe
pics, docs, programs, then plug in ipod to computer
and drag to new computer.  its like a portable hard
drive.
